What Are E-Transfer Loans on Social Assistance?
E-transfer loans on social assistance are short-term loans designed for individuals receiving government benefits, such as disability support, employment insurance, or social assistance. These loans provide quick access to cash through Interac e-Transfer, making them an ideal solution for those who need emergency funds but have limited financial options.
Unlike traditional bank loans, e-transfer loans do not require extensive paperwork, long processing times, or high credit scores. Borrowers can apply online and receive the funds within hours, making them a reliable choice for urgent financial needs.
How Do E-Transfer Loans on Social Assistance Work?
E-transfer loans are straightforward and easy to apply for:
- Complete an Online Application – Provide basic details, including proof of social assistance income.
- Get Approved Quickly – Since lenders focus on income rather than credit scores, approval is fast.
- Receive Funds via E-Transfer – Once approved, the money is sent instantly through Interac e-Transfer.
- Repay Over Time – Repayment is usually scheduled on your next benefit payment date or in installments.

Who Can Apply for E-Transfer Loans on Social Assistance?
Most lenders have simple eligibility requirements, including:
- Being at least 18 years old
- Receiving regular social assistance payments (e.g., ODSP, EI, CPP, welfare)
- Having a valid Canadian bank account for e-transfer deposits
- Providing identification and proof of income
Some lenders may also require a history of receiving benefits for a certain period before approval.
Things to Consider Before Applying
Interest Rates Fees
E-transfer loans often come with high-interest rates. Always compare lenders to find the most affordable option.
Repayment Terms
Ensure you understand the repayment schedule to avoid missed payments and additional fees.
Borrow Responsibly
Only borrow what you need and can afford to repay without putting yourself in financial difficulty.
Alternative Financial Options
If you're on social assistance and need financial help, consider these alternatives:
- Credit Union Loans – Some credit unions offer small, low-interest loans for individuals with fixed incomes.
- Government Assistance Programs – Additional benefits or emergency assistance programs may be available.
- Community Financial Aid – Local charities and non-profits sometimes offer interest-free loans or grants.
